    Final Fantasy III was originally released in Japan under the name of FinalFantasy III. Those who are looking at this and haven't played it may beconfused because the rest of the world also has a different Final Fantasy III.

    THAT Final Fantasy III was remade in the mid-2000s as Final Fantasy VI Advance,which is what it was in Japan (minus the "Advance"). The true Final Fantasy IIIfinally came to the U.S. as a full DS remake - graphics and all. Truly a newgame versus what there was before.

    O===========================================================================O| DUAL-WIELD OR SHIELD? || || A fair topic of debate in any game with strategy, such as this, is || whether you should opt to wield two weapons simultaneously or to have || one weapon and one shield. Dual-wielding allows you to do a much larger || amount of damage than before, because your Attack option will be, in || effect, used TWICE. However, this also lowers your Defense by not || letting you hold a shield. Holding a shield can be valuable in that it || can raise your Defense and you'll stay around longer. || || So, which should you do? I, personally, ALWAYS dual-wield weaponry when || possible. However, if it takes away another's weapons, I'll let them |

    | both wield one weapon and one shield. In short, dual-wield only when it || it convenient to the party as a whole. || |O===========================================================================O

    First and foremost, you'll want to have two things equipped: the Wightslayeryou got from Castle Sasune, and the Bow with some Holy Arrows. Both of theseabuse weaknesses of the enemies in this dungeon; all of these enemies are weakto Light/Holy-elemental damage. If you lack these for a character, simply gowith Longswords. Note that Bow-users should be in the back row, since Bows arelong-range and do the same damage, but the user will take half-damage.

    I will also note that Cure spells will damage these undead enemies as well, butI highly recommend against this unless you are in dire need of defeating the

    enemies. MP is limited at your likely levels.

    You poof back up in the Wind Crystal shrine. The Crystal bestows a task uponyou, the Warriors of Light. The world's light is fading, the equilibrium ofthe planet is at risk. Much like the previous two Final Fantasies, the world'secology will go into chaos if the world's Crystals' light and the forces ofevil are not restored and banished, respectively.

    So the Wind Crystal gives you the ability to switch jobs. Of the jobs you havejust obtained, you'll be allowed to be a Warrior, Thief, Monk, Black Mage,White Mage, or Red Mage.

    Personally, I choose a Warrior, a Thief, and two Red Mages. Red Mages are justBlack-White Mage mixtures. Good enough for early gameplay. Do what you will.

    After entering town, Refia runs off to meet with her foster father. Okay, letus shop. Hope you've gotten plenty of money; a lot of this can be a major setof upgrades.

    Warriors and Red Mages will want one or two Mythril Swords apiece. They havemore power than the Wightslayer. Note, however, enemies in the next area willbe undead, so keep the Wightslayer until we're done there. Thieves will stickwith Mythril Daggers, Black Mages with the Mythril Rod(s), and White Mages andMonks stay empty-handed for now.

    Note that I would recommend holding out on two of the Mythril Swordpurchases. We'll soon head into the Mythril Mines of Kazus, which have twoMythril Swords at the end. Whatever would be replaced should still be okay to

  • 8/22/2019 Final Fantasy III (and) FAQ_Walkthrough

    17/396

    make it through the short dungeon.

    Armor-wise, Mythril Armor for your Warriors, Red Mages, and Thieves. A bitcosty, but a definite good idea. Mythril Shields are okay if you decide not todual-wield. Mythril Helms also go for the aforementioned three. Mythril Glovesare nice on Warriors, Monks, and Thieves. Mythril Bracers go for your threeMages.

    Now that you've spent a fairly large amount of money, we'll spend a bit more.You'll want spells. Fire and Blizzard are the only two worth worrying about.YOU WILL NOT WANT TO MAKE A CHARACTER ALWAYS PHYSICAL. Every character will bepretty much forced into spellcasting at some point, so you had best prepare forit now. Get one Blizzard and Fire spell for all who lack one at the moment.Sleep isn't worth it all too much in my book, but do as you will.

    (A note on my above big note. You can only teach spells to people of a certainjob class: in this case, Black or Red Mage. Note that I do NOT recommendchanging jobs twice just to teach someone something then go back. If they cannot learn it now, just let them learn it when it is needed and save it untilthen.)

    First and foremost, you'll need someone to be at Level 8 or higher to learnMini as a White Mage; if you're not higher than that, shame on you, etc. Youwill need to have *someone* know Mini. Then cast it on your whole party inthe field, preferably, to make them Minimized, thereby letting them be able toenter Tozus.

    But not so fast! When you are Minimized, your physical stats suck more than asupermassive black hole. You will want to have everyone be some type of Mage. Iwould either go for four Red Mages or three Black Mages with one White Mage.Take your pick. Put everyone in the back row as well, to lessen damage --again, refer to the second sentence of this paragraph.

    Finally, I told you for some ingenious reason to buy and/or obtain four ofevery spell buyable for the most part. These mostly include Cure, Fire,Blizzard, Thunder, and Poison if you felt like it. EVERYONE NEEDS ONE OF EACHif they are a Red Mage. All Black Mages need the latter four, and White Magesonly really get Cure. That's why I prefer Red Mages - you have versatility!The one doing the highest damage with magic should use Aero, so swap around ifneeded.

    Once you have Minimized everyone, and then have changed their jobs to ones ofmagic, and THEN put everyone in the back row, examine the HP/MP healingspring to give them their full MP to be able to cast spells in battle.

    Finally, Desch has joined your party as a guest and will for a fair while,being an amnesiac and all. He will be very helpful: he can attack an enemyphysically, or he can blast all enemies with Thundara, both usually resultingin kills.
